Who pays who in a real estate transaction?  The seller hires a real estate agent.  They decide on how much of the Listing Agent’s commission will be offered to a Cooperating Agent (also called the Buyer’s Agent or the Selling Agent). Who pays the Buyer’s Agent? The Seller’s Agent.  What if the Buyer uses more than one agent?  The only agent for the buyer who gets paid is the agent who writes the offer.  Sounds simple but it gets mixed up by people all the time.  Being a real estate agent is a commission based job. No one will pay you to be a tour guide.  So we ask Buyers PLEASE be loyal to your agent! Don’t click on the “For more information” button on a real estate website like Zillow or Redfin. Just send the address you see online to your real estate agent and give them a chance to do the work.  If you think the more agents who are looking for properties for you, the better chance you will find the right properties than you are inherently wasting the time of all the agents who don’t end up writing the offer. Only that one agent has the ball and could carry it to closing and get paid. Be loyal.
